InvestHK

• Establish 2000, a government organization helps to attract and retain foreign direct investment

• In 2010, InvestHK has completed 284 projects involving direct investment of some $8.1 billion and the creation of around 3 000 new jobs

2006 2007 2008 2009 2010

# of project done

246 253 257 265 284

1st year job created

3092 3130 2450 2711 3063

2nd year job created

7835 8134 7881 6033 5927

Hong Kong Science and Technology Park

• Established 2001, a statutory body by the government. It focuses on innovative and technology development

• Estimate Phase 3 of Park finish late 2013-16, focus on foster environment and renewable energy technology.

• Approximately 5000 related construction job during construction and 4000 R-D related professional positions will be created when Phase 3 construction complete

Technology• The Business Incubation Programmes

(Incu-Tech, Incu-Bio and Incu-Design) offered by Hong Kong Science & Technology Parks Corporation (HKSTPC) aims to provide a comprehensive package of assistance for technology and design start-ups. Eligible companies are granted financial aid, rent-free offices or laboratory premises up to 12 months and other forms of assistance. This program aims to foster new entrepreneurship for Hong Kong

Tolerance• Hong Kong International Film

Festival (HKIFF) takes places in March and April every year. As one of the oldest film festivals in Asia.

• HKIFF values diversity and features a wide variety of films from different parts of the world covering different genres.

• Every year the HKIFF shows over 300 films from more than 50 countries

Population DemographicEthnicity 2001 Number % of Total 2006 Number % of Total

Chinese 6,364,439 94.9% 6,522,148 95.0%

Filipino 142,556 2.1% 112,453 1.6%

Indonesian 50,494 0.8% 87,840 1.3%

Westerners 46,585 0.7% 36,384 0.5%

Indian 18,543 0.3% 20,444 0.3%

Nepalese 12,564 0.2% 15,950 0.2%

Japanese 14,180 0.2% 13,189 0.2%

Thai 14,342 0.2% 11,900 0.2%

Pakistani 11,017 0.2% 11,111 0.2%

Other Asian 12,835 0.2% 12,663 0.2%

Others 20,835 0.3% 20,264 0.3%

Total 6,708,389 100.0% 6,864,346 100.0%
